Accelerator cards enhance computing performance and are increasingly used in data centers, AI processing, and high-performance computing environments in the Philippines. Growth in cloud services, digital transformation, and e-governance initiatives is driving this market, with demand coming from both public and private IT infrastructure sectors.
The accelerator card market in the Philippines is witnessing strong growth, primarily driven by data center expansion, high-performance computing needs, and the proliferation of AI applications. These cards are being increasingly adopted by enterprises to offload and speed up compute-intensive tasks, such as machine learning inference and video encoding. As cloud services grow in popularity and local firms invest in digital transformation, demand for FPGA, GPU, and ASIC-based accelerator cards is expected to rise sharply.
The accelerator card market encounters challenges linked to rapid technological advancements in computing, requiring constant upgrades and innovation. High manufacturing costs and dependency on imported components restrict local production capabilities. Additionally, market demand fluctuates with the cyclic nature of industries such as data centers and AI applications, making investment risky. Compatibility with diverse hardware platforms also complicates adoption.
